
Will Johnson Sets Workout Date for NFL Teams, Will Visit Raiders Before 2025 Draft
Michigan cornerback Will Johnson will stage a formal workout for NFL teams on April 14 in Ann Arbor, Michigan, according to NFL Network's Ian Rapoport.
Johnson also plans to meet with the Las Vegas Raiders in Sin City on April 15.
A hamstring injury prevented the defensive standout from participating in Michigan's pro day this spring.

In terms of his draft stock, next week's workout is unlikely to move the needle too much for Johnson because he's already a highly regarded prospect. He's the No. 5 overall player and second-best corner behind Colorado's Travis Hunter on Bleacher Report's 2025 big board.
B/R NFL scout Cory Giddings compared Johnson to 2020 Pro Bowler James Bradberry.
"His combination of size, length, physicality and versatility in coverage make him a valuable asset for any defensive scheme," Giddings wrote. "While he will need to refine his change of direction and reduce his tendency to gamble in coverage, Johnson's ability to disrupt plays both in the air and on the ground gives him a high ceiling. With proper coaching and development, Johnson can potentially become a top-tier defensive back in the NFL."
The Raiders were in the middle of the pack against the pass in 2024. They ranked 15th in yards allowed (216.2 per game) and 24th in opponent passer rating (96.5).
The biggest indication Las Vegas might be targeting a cornerback in the draft came when the team cut Jack Jones, who led the team in interceptions and appeared in every game last year.
Johnson makes plenty of sense as an immediate replacement for Jones in the secondary.
